Quality Assurance Within A Specialized Electric Fireplace PCBA Factory
The production of high-performance electronics requires an environment that prioritizes precision and environmental control. An electric fireplace pcba factory operates under strict standards to ensure that every board produced can withstand the test of time. Because fireplaces generate significant internal heat, the printed circuit board assembly (PCBA) must utilize high-temperature laminates and specialized soldering techniques to prevent thermal fatigue. A world-class factory employs automated optical inspection and functional testing to verify that every trace and component meets the exact specifications required for safe operation.
Beyond the physical assembly, an electric fireplace pcba factory manages the complex supply chain of semi-conductors and sensors. In a global market where component availability can be volatile, having a factory partner with strong procurement networks is essential for maintaining consistent production schedules. These facilities also focus on “design for manufacturability,” ensuring that the complex layouts required for smart features—such as Wi-Fi modules and touch-sensitive interfaces—can be produced at scale without compromising quality. This meticulous attention to detail at the factory level translates directly into lower failure rates and higher consumer satisfaction once the product reaches the home.
Engineering Excellence In The OEM Electric Fireplace Control Board
Reliability is the silent ambassador of a brand. When a customer interacts with their home heating system, they expect instantaneous response and absolute safety. The oem electric fireplace control board is engineered to meet these expectations through rigorous hardware-level protections. These boards are equipped with multiple sensors to monitor for overheating, blocked air intakes, and electrical surges. By integrating these safety protocols directly into the silicon, manufacturers can provide peace of mind to their customers while meeting stringent international safety certifications such as UL or CE.
The software firmware residing on an oem electric fireplace control board is equally important. It manages the delicate synchronization between the heating element’s power draw and the LED lighting system that creates the flame effect. If the synchronization is off, the illusion of a real fire is broken. Advanced OEM boards use sophisticated pulse-width modulation to create smooth transitions in light intensity and fan speed, resulting in a more natural and relaxing atmosphere. This harmony between hardware and software is what characterizes a premium electric fireplace and keeps the brand at the forefront of the industry.
Delivering A Comprehensive Smart Electric Fireplace Solution
The modern consumer views their fireplace as a node within a larger ecosystem. Providing a complete smart electric fireplace solution means thinking beyond the heating coil. It involves the seamless integration of voice control via platforms like Amazon Alexa or Google Home, allowing users to adjust the “fire” with a simple command. It also means incorporating energy-harvesting technologies and eco-modes that reduce power consumption when the room reaches the desired temperature, aligning the product with the global trend toward sustainable living.
A truly holistic smart electric fireplace solution also addresses the importance of the user interface. Whether it is a sleek glass touch panel on the unit itself or a feature-rich smartphone application, the interaction must be intuitive and elegant. Through advanced data processing, these smart systems can even provide diagnostic feedback to the user, such as notifying them when a filter needs cleaning or if the system requires a software update. By focusing on the entire lifecycle of the user experience, from the initial “spark” of the flame to the long-term maintenance of the unit, manufacturers can build lasting loyalty.
